[Wikidata-bugs] [Maniphest] [Commented On] T249715: Add capability to provoke generic save error to browser tests

2020-04-27 Thread gerritbot
gerritbot added a comment.


  Change 592257 **merged** by jenkins-bot:
  [mediawiki/extensions/Wikibase@master] bridge: Add capability to provoke 
generic save error to browser tests
  
  https://gerrit.wikimedia.org/r/592257

TASK DETAIL
  https://phabricator.wikimedia.org/T249715

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Michael, gerritbot
Cc: Pablo-WMDE, Lucas_Werkmeister_WMDE, Aklapper, Blissjay007, Oblanco79, 
Alter-paule, Beast1978, Un1tY, Sarai-WMDE, Hook696, Daryl-TTMG, RomaAmorRoma, 
E.S.A-Sheild, darthmon_wmde, Kent7301, Meekrab2012, joker88john, Michael, 
CucyNoiD, Nandana, NebulousIris, Gaboe420, Versusxo, Majesticalreaper22, 
Giuliamocci, Adrian1985, Cpaulf30, Lahi, Gq86, Af420, Darkminds3113, Bsandipan, 
Lordiis, GoranSMilovanovic,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, 
LawExplorer, WSH1906, Lewizho99, Maathavan, _jensen, rosalieper, Scott_WUaS, 
Wikidata-bugs, aude,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T249715: Add capability to provoke generic save error to browser tests

2020-04-23 Thread Pablo-WMDE
Pablo-WMDE added a comment.


  > not sure whether it will ever acquire more functions than those two.
  
  At least it will have an intuitive, easy to discover file name then.
  
  I can totally see this functionality in wdio-mediawiki as well (it also has a 
`Util` already). Maybe we can suggest it there and keep our own clone for now - 
getting the best of the boyscout rule //and// rapid iterations.

TASK DETAIL
  https://phabricator.wikimedia.org/T249715

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Michael, Pablo-WMDE
Cc: Pablo-WMDE, Lucas_Werkmeister_WMDE, Aklapper, Blissjay007, Oblanco79, 
Alter-paule, Beast1978, Un1tY, Sarai-WMDE, Hook696, Daryl-TTMG, RomaAmorRoma, 
E.S.A-Sheild, darthmon_wmde, Kent7301, Meekrab2012, joker88john, Michael, 
CucyNoiD, Nandana, NebulousIris, Gaboe420, Versusxo, Majesticalreaper22, 
Giuliamocci, Adrian1985, Cpaulf30, Lahi, Gq86, Af420, Darkminds3113, Bsandipan, 
Lordiis, GoranSMilovanovic,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, 
LawExplorer, WSH1906, Lewizho99, Maathavan, _jensen, rosalieper, Scott_WUaS, 
Wikidata-bugs, aude,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T249715: Add capability to provoke generic save error to browser tests

2020-04-23 Thread Michael
Michael added a comment.


  In T249715#6079408 , 
@Pablo-WMDE wrote:
  
  > Hmm, I see a `canSave.js` patch landed. Was about to add such a test to the 
(new) errorHandling test, using network outage as the reason for the initial 
loading to fail (retry does hardly make sense on an invalid entity id [the only 
pre-existing case]). I'd be happy with no util at all, or it moving into the 
page objects (or any other centrally reachable place), but an individual spec 
will almost always leave something to be desired…
  
  Makes sense. Since there now might be multiple places after all where we 
might need it, I opted for a separate `NetworkUtils.js` file, though I'm not 
sure whether it will ever acquire more functions than those two.

TASK DETAIL
  https://phabricator.wikimedia.org/T249715

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Michael
Cc: Pablo-WMDE, Lucas_Werkmeister_WMDE, Aklapper, Blissjay007, Oblanco79, 
Alter-paule, Beast1978, Un1tY, Sarai-WMDE, Hook696, Daryl-TTMG, RomaAmorRoma, 
E.S.A-Sheild, darthmon_wmde, Kent7301, Meekrab2012, joker88john, Michael, 
CucyNoiD, Nandana, NebulousIris, Gaboe420, Versusxo, Majesticalreaper22, 
Giuliamocci, Adrian1985, Cpaulf30, Lahi, Gq86, Af420, Darkminds3113, Bsandipan, 
Lordiis, GoranSMilovanovic,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, 
LawExplorer, WSH1906, Lewizho99, Maathavan, _jensen, rosalieper, Scott_WUaS, 
Wikidata-bugs, aude,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T249715: Add capability to provoke generic save error to browser tests

2020-04-23 Thread Pablo-WMDE
Pablo-WMDE added a comment.


  Hmm, I see a `canSave.js` patch landed. Was about to add such a test to the 
(new) errorHandling test, using network outage as the reason for the initial 
loading to fail (retry does hardly make sense on in invalid entity id [the only 
pre-existing case]). I'd be happy with no util at all, or it moving into the 
page objects (or any other centrally reachable place), but an individual spec 
will almost always leave something to be desired…

TASK DETAIL
  https://phabricator.wikimedia.org/T249715

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Michael, Pablo-WMDE
Cc: Pablo-WMDE, Lucas_Werkmeister_WMDE, Aklapper, Blissjay007, Oblanco79, 
Alter-paule, Beast1978, Un1tY, Sarai-WMDE, Hook696, Daryl-TTMG, RomaAmorRoma, 
E.S.A-Sheild, darthmon_wmde, Kent7301, Meekrab2012, joker88john, Michael, 
CucyNoiD, Nandana, NebulousIris, Gaboe420, Versusxo, Majesticalreaper22, 
Giuliamocci, Adrian1985, Cpaulf30, Lahi, Gq86, Af420, Darkminds3113, Bsandipan, 
Lordiis, GoranSMilovanovic,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, 
LawExplorer, WSH1906, Lewizho99, Maathavan, _jensen, rosalieper, Scott_WUaS, 
Wikidata-bugs, aude,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T249715: Add capability to provoke generic save error to browser tests

2020-04-23 Thread gerritbot
gerritbot added a comment.


  Change 592257 had a related patch set uploaded (by Michael Große; owner: 
Michael Große):
  [mediawiki/extensions/Wikibase@master] bridge: Add capability to provoke 
generic save error to browser tests
  
  https://gerrit.wikimedia.org/r/592257

TASK DETAIL
  https://phabricator.wikimedia.org/T249715

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Michael, gerritbot
Cc: Lucas_Werkmeister_WMDE, Aklapper, Sarai-WMDE, darthmon_wmde, Michael, 
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, LawExplorer, _jensen, 
rosalieper, Scott_WUaS, Wikidata-bugs, aude,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T249715: Add capability to provoke generic save error to browser tests

2020-04-22 Thread Lucas_Werkmeister_WMDE
Lucas_Werkmeister_WMDE added a comment.


  > I'm not sure that this needs to be wrapped in a helper function on its own. 
If it does - where would that helper function live?
  
  Since we’ll likely only need it for the save tests, I’d put it in 
`specs/canSave.js`.

TASK DETAIL
  https://phabricator.wikimedia.org/T249715

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Michael, Lucas_Werkmeister_WMDE
Cc: Lucas_Werkmeister_WMDE, Aklapper, Sarai-WMDE, darthmon_wmde, Michael, 
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, LawExplorer, _jensen, 
rosalieper, Scott_WUaS, Wikidata-bugs, aude,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s